Home
last modified time | relevance | path

Searched refs:p_sigacts (Results 1 – 11 of 11) sorted by relevance

/xnu-12377.41.6/bsd/kern/
H A Dkern_synch.c98 if (p->p_sigacts.ps_sigintr & sigmask(sig)) { in _sleep_continue()
224 if (p->p_sigacts.ps_sigintr & sigmask(sig)) { in _sleep()
298 if (p->p_sigacts.ps_sigintr & sigmask(sig)) { in _sleep()
H A Dkern_fork.c756 p->p_sigacts.ps_sigact[sig] = sigact; in proc_set_sigact()
764 p->p_sigacts.ps_trampact[sig] = trampact; in proc_set_trampact()
772 p->p_sigacts.ps_sigact[sig] = sigact; in proc_set_sigact_trampact()
773 p->p_sigacts.ps_trampact[sig] = trampact; in proc_set_sigact_trampact()
779 user_addr_t *sigacts = p->p_sigacts.ps_sigact; in proc_reset_sigact()
938 child_proc->p_sigacts = parent_proc->p_sigacts; in forkproc()
H A Dkern_sig.c446 struct sigacts *ps = &p->p_sigacts; in sigaction()
635 struct sigacts *ps = &p->p_sigacts; in setsigvec()
734 struct sigacts *ps = &p->p_sigacts; in execsigs()
3062 struct sigacts *ps = &p->p_sigacts; in postsig_locked()
3104 p->p_sigacts.ps_sig = signum; in postsig_locked()
H A Dkern_proc.c1814 (p->p_sigacts.ps_sig < 1) || (p->p_sigacts.ps_sig >= NSIG) || in proc_isabortedsignal()
1815 !hassigprop(p->p_sigacts.ps_sig, SA_CORE))) { in proc_isabortedsignal()
/xnu-12377.41.6/bsd/sys/
H A Dsignalvar.h94 #define SIGACTION(p, sig) ({ p->p_sigacts.ps_sigact[(sig)]; })
95 #define SIGTRAMP(p, sig) ({ p->p_sigacts.ps_trampact[(sig)]; })
H A Dproc_internal.h319 struct sigacts p_sigacts; member
646 uint32_t p_sigacts; /* Signal actions, state (PROC ONLY). */ member
698 user_addr_t p_sigacts; /* Signal actions, state (PROC ONLY). */ member
H A Dproc.h115 struct sigacts *p_sigacts; /* Signal actions, state (PROC ONLY). */ member
/xnu-12377.41.6/bsd/uxkern/
H A Dux_exception.c160 struct sigacts *ps = &p->p_sigacts; in handle_ux_exception()
/xnu-12377.41.6/bsd/dev/arm/
H A Dunix_signal.c306 struct sigacts *ps = &p->p_sigacts; in sendsig()
802 struct sigacts *ps = &p->p_sigacts; in sigreturn()
/xnu-12377.41.6/bsd/dev/i386/
H A Dunix_signal.c184 struct sigacts *ps = &p->p_sigacts; in sendsig()
785 struct sigacts *ps = &p->p_sigacts; in sigreturn()
/xnu-12377.41.6/bsd/security/audit/
H A Daudit.c961 ar->k_ar.ar_arg_signum = proc->p_sigacts.ps_sig; in audit_proc_coredump()